A simple little box
After seeing some of the amazing work posted lately, I am almost ashame to post my latest little creation
I started this box a little over a week ago and it is only my 4th to date. It is made of Padauk and jointed with Rabbets and then finished out with the round over bit. Finished with 2 dousings of Teak oil followed by 4 coats of General Finishes wiping Poly. Waxed using 0000 steel wool and then buffed on the wheel.
I thought it turned out pretty nice for a simple and early box.
